At Putney train station, you can expect convenience at every turn. The ticket office is operational from Monday to Saturday between 06:25 to 20:10, and Sunday from 07:10 to 20:10. In the absence of staff, the numerous ticket machines are always available, ensuring passengers can purchase tickets and collect their online bookings at any time. Accessible ticket machines are equipped to handle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, providing inclusivity for all users.
Though there is no luggage storage or waiting rooms, passengers can rest easy knowing there's CCTV coverage throughout the premises, ensuring safety at all times. While Putney station does not offer refreshment facilities or shops, there's an ATM for your convenience.
Putney station prides itself on accessibility, offering step-free access across all platforms, making it user-friendly for passengers with mobility difficulties. Although there are no wheelchair-accessible taxis directly available at the station, staff are always on hand to assist customers moving through the station or boarding trains.
Particularly noteworthy is the availability of accessible toilets, although other amenities such as seating areas and baby changing facilities are absent. Public Wi-Fi is available, allowing you to stay connected while on the move.

Derby Train Station is well-equipped to handle a variety of passenger needs. The ticket office operates with extensive hours, from early morning at 04:55 until late at night at 22:45 during the week, with slightly adjusted hours on the weekend. For those who prefer digital solutions, ticket machines are available and include facilities for collecting online purchases. Accessibility is a focus here, with step-free access across the entire station, supported by lifts and tactile paving.
This station has a notable commitment to customer assistance and safety. Staff are readily available to help, and several help points are dotted around for immediate inquiries. While there are no luggage storage facilities, the lost property office at Nottingham offers a robust service for misplaced items. Safety is enhanced with CCTV covering both the station and car park areas.
For seamless transitions to other modes of transportation, Derby Train Station offers several options. A taxi rank can be found on the station forecourt for quick, convenient transfers. The KinchBus's "Skylink" service operates a 24-hour schedule connecting passengers directly to East Midlands Airport, ensuring easy access to international travel.
Bus services are also comprehensively covered, with information readily available and even in a printable format for the organized traveler. For those moments when regular service is disrupted, rail replacement services can be accessed from the Pride Park exit, ensuring continuity of travel.

For daily commuters and travelers with bicycles, Derby Station provides 204 sheltered bike spaces equipped with CCTV for peace of mind. The car park runs 24 hours with a range of tickets catering to short and long stays, making it convenient for all types of travelers. Refreshment facilities at the station ensure you are fueled and ready for your journey, and while there's no public Wi-Fi, the spacious waiting areas come with comfortable seating and heating.
